🔐 Authentication Setup

To run an actual scan, you need a valid Cloudflare API Token.

How to Get a Valid API Token

  1. Log in to Cloudflare Dashboard

  2. Navigate to API Tokens

  3. Create API Token

    • Click "Create Token"
    • Choose "Read all resources" template OR create custom token
  4. Required Permissions (for custom token):

    Zone - Zone - Read
    Zone - Zone Settings - Read
    Zone - Firewall Services - Read
    Account - Account Settings - Read
    
  5. Copy the Token

    • After creation, copy the token immediately (it won't be shown again)
    • Token format: xx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xx

Testing with Your Token

Once you have a valid token:

# Set as environment variable
export CLOUDFLARE_API_TOKEN="your-actual-token-here"

# Or pass directly
poetry run python prowler-cli.py cloudflare --api-token "your-actual-token-here"

🐛 Troubleshooting

Error: "Invalid API Token"

Cause: The token you provided is invalid or expired.

Solution:

  1. Generate a new token following the steps above
  2. Ensure the token hasn't expired
  3. Verify the token has the required permissions

Error: "No such file or directory: compliance/cloudflare"

Solution: Already fixed! The compliance directory has been created.

Error: "Module not found"

Solution:

# Clear Python cache
find prowler -name "__pycache__" -type d -exec rm -rf {} +

# Reinstall dependencies
poetry install

🚀 Quick Start (Once You Have a Token)

# 1. Get your Cloudflare API token from the dashboard

# 2. Set environment variable
export CLOUDFLARE_API_TOKEN="your-token"

# 3. Run scan
poetry run python prowler-cli.py cloudflare

# 4. Or scan specific zones
poetry run python prowler-cli.py cloudflare --zone-id zone_abc123

# 5. Or run specific checks
poetry run python prowler-cli.py cloudflare -c ssl_tls_minimum_version
